About This Item

New York: Bantam Books, 1966. First Edition, Later Printing. . Mass Market Paperback. Good Plus to Very Good. Vintage paperback, Bantam E3184; L'Amour's story of Shalako, a lone gunfighter protecting a rich woman's huntring party, which is, in turn, hunted by Apaches; the basis for a movie starring Sean Connery and Brigette Bardot, mass market paperback, Fourth Printing of Paperback Original First Edition; text is tight, clean, age-browned, a slight spine lean in pictorial wrappers with reading crease, small tear at top of back cover, minor surface and edgewear and discoloration.
